ALEXANDRIA, Va., July 16 -- United States Patent no. 12,361,908, issued on July 15, was assigned to LAPIS Technology Co. Ltd. (Yokohama, Japan).

"Display apparatus, source driver, and gradation voltage generating circuit" was invented by Kenji Yanagawa (Yokohama, Japan).

According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A source driver of the disclosure supplies a display device having a plurality of display cells with gradation voltages corresponding to respective luminance levels for the display cells indicated by a video signal.
